Key Responsibilities

  • •Manage all areas of project management for commercial real estate projects, covering planning through closeout.
  • •Interface with clients to define project scope, delivery resources, cost estimates and budgets, schedules, quality control, and risk identification.
  • •Conduct standard request for proposals (RFPs), complete bid evaluations, and recommend project delivery resources.
  • •Implement project documentation governance aligned to company and client requirements and ensure project data integrity.
  • •Build action plans, track project progress and variances, and develop risk mitigation and contingency plans.

Key Requirements

  • •Must be currently authorized to work in the United States without visa sponsorship now or in the future.
  • •5–8 years of relevant experience (Bachelor’s Degree preferred; degree substitution allowed).
  • •Retail commercial real estate construction project management experience.
  • •Proficiency in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, Outlook, PowerPoint) and Smartsheet experience is beneficial.
  • •General knowledge of leases, contracts, and construction practices, with ability to read architectural drawings.
